			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>QB Vince Young has reportedly worked out with the Buffalo Bills.  Being the good citizen that I am, it is my duty to tell the Bills to watch out!</p>
<p>As a Jaguars fan I had the pleasure of watching Vince Young fail for five seasons in Tennessee.  He never amassed more than nine victories in a season, he had some psychological problems that made one wonder what was going on in Tennessee, and he appeared to think he was God&#8217;s gift to football (no offense to him, he was pretty good back in Texas!).</p>
<p>I thought the Eagles would do him some good last season.  Then came the now infamous &#8220;Dream Team&#8221; label placed on the  free spending Eagles by none other than Young himself &#8211; the backup quarterback.</p>
<p>In the three games he did start, young threw nine picks, four touchdowns, averaged 7.6 yards per attempt, and had a 1-2 win-loss record. I&#8217;m not saying he was terrible, but he definitely wasn&#8217;t the man to lead the team when they needed someone to replace Michael Vick.  I bet it made Andy Reid miss Kevin Kolb&#8230;  Young isn&#8217;t terrible, but he has gaffs that make our current Vice President look perfectly eloquent.  Young isn&#8217;t very effective, still has a Texas sized ego, and brings more of a headache than relief.  It&#8217;s a good thing for the AFC South that he&#8217;s out of there.</p>
<p>I don&#8217;t mean this as a thrashing of Vince Young, I mean this more as a public service announcement for the Buffalo Bills.  I know I&#8217;m not in charge of personnel up in New York, but if I was I would have a number of questions before letting Young backup Ryan Fitzpatrick.</p>
